Dogs are the most populous member of the Carnivora order, with an estimated global population between 700 million to over 1 billion. They come in many breeds, including playful dogs like Goldadors and Golden doodles, as well as working dogs like the German Shorthaired Pointer. Some facts: Newfoundlands have webbed feet and water resistant coats for fishing rescues, while Pomeranians and Pekingese survived the Titanic sinking from first class. Popular breeds are described like the German Shepherd, a large working dog from Germany, and the German Shorthaired Pointer, a medium to large hunting dog developed in Germany for its speed and agility.
